Topics Covered in NVQ Level 4 Health & Social Care

When pursuing an NVQ Level 4 in Health & Social Care, you can expect to cover a wide range of topics that are essential for advancing your knowledge and skills in this field. Here are some of the key areas that are typically included in the curriculum:

Topic Description
1. Leadership and Management Developing skills in leading and managing teams, implementing policies and procedures, and ensuring quality care delivery.
2. Health and Safety Understanding and implementing health and safety regulations to create a safe environment for both staff and service users.
3. Communication and Interpersonal Skills Enhancing communication skills to effectively interact with colleagues, service users, and their families.
4. Safeguarding and Protection Learning how to identify and respond to safeguarding concerns, protecting vulnerable individuals from harm.
5. Person-Centered Care Focusing on individual needs and preferences to provide personalized care that respects the dignity and autonomy of service users.

These are just a few examples of the topics covered in an NVQ Level 4 in Health & Social Care. By mastering these areas, you will be well-equipped to excel in your career and make a positive impact on the lives of those you care for.
